> You need the logging to find out what is happening if things are not 
> working as expected. Fulcrum did not log anything.
> 
> It works for me, both the LocalizationService as some own developed 
> services. LocalizationService is (late) inited, only when used for first 
> time, so you only see in your log file that the mapping is added.
> 
> My log file (using log4j with Turbine logging) shows:
> [09:43:50,401 INFO ] loading component: name=fulcrum 
> class=org.apache.fulcrum.Fulcrum 
> config=/home/bselders/work/src/concedo-permit/target/webapps/concedo-permit/
> WEB-INF/conf/Fulcrum.properties
> [09:43:50,401 DEBUG] attempting to load 'org.apache.fulcrum.Fulcrum' 
> with the config file 
> '/home/bselders/work/src/concedo-permit/target/webapps/concedo-permit/WEB-IN
> F/conf/Fulcrum.properties'.
> [09:43:50,490 INFO ] Added Mapping for Service: DatabaseService
> [09:43:50,491 INFO ] Added Mapping for Service: PersistenceService
> [09:43:50,491 INFO ] Added Mapping for Service: LocalizationService
> [09:43:50,491 INFO ] Start Initializing service (early): DatabaseService
> [09:43:50,521 INFO ] Start Initializing service (late): DatabaseService
> [09:43:52,263 INFO ] Finished initializing all services!
> [09:43:52,263 DEBUG] good news! org.apache.fulcrum.Fulcrum successfully 
> configured and initialized
> [09:43:52,263 INFO ] Turbine: init() Ready to Rumble!
> 
> Some other tips worthwile to consider:
> I am accessing the service through the 
> org.apache.fulcrum.localization.Localization class as documented in the 
> docs at 
> http://jakarta.apache.org/turbine/fulcrum/howto/localization-service.html
> 
> Did you comment out the 'old' LocalizationService from TR.properties?
> 
> I am also using the fulcrum-3.0-b2-dev.jar from 
> http://jakarta.apache.org/turbine/jars.

>>>In order to get Fulcrum to log I had to do one of the following:
>>>
>>>- Either create a log4j.properties file and put it in WEB-INF/classes
>>> See log4j website for details on what to specify.
>>>
>>>- Or alternatively (and easier for T2.2 users) log everything in one log
>>>file
>>> To do that I use the following log settings in TR.properties:
>>>
>>>  services.LoggingService.facilities=system,debug,security,logforj
>>>  services.LoggingService.default=logforj
>>>  services.LoggingService.loggingConfig=
>>>org.apache.turbine.services.logging.PropertiesLoggingConfig
>>>
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.rootCategory = ALL, logforj
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.category.logforj = ALL, logforj
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.appender.logforj.file
>>>=${webappRoot}/logs/turbine.log
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.appender.logforj =
>>>org.apache.log4j.FileAppender
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.appender.logforj.layout =
>>>org.apache.log4j.PatternLayout
>>>
>>>services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.appender.logforj.layout.conversionPa
>>
> tt
> 
>>>ern = [%d{ABSOLUTE} %-5p] %m%n
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.log4j.appender.logforj.append = false
>>>
>>>services.LoggingService.logforj.className=org.apache.turbine.services.logg
>>
> in
> 
>>>g.Log4JavaLogger
>>>  services.LoggingService.logforj.level=ALL
>>>
>>>Set the level to one of: ALL, DEBUG, INFO dependent on your need.
